Some people use coat hangers and bobby pins to gain access to their car when they have been locked out. This is not a wise idea because it can damage your vehicle. It could also trigger an alarm, which could cost you hundreds of dollars in repairs. Modern cars have sophisticated locks, which require professional locksmiths to open the door.

Car VAT System
Many GM cars produced in the 1980s were equipped with a VATS system. The system is identified through a resistor attached to the metal blade of an ignition key. It can differentiate between different resistance values. If the wrong value is detected, the VATS control module will not allow the engine to start. It will also turn the security light to turn on or an error message will be displayed in the Driver Information Center, depending on the vehicle. This will allow the prospective car thief a few minutes of delay, which will give them enough time to consider whether to go ahead with the theft or find an easier target.
The VATS system was developed after a lot of studies were done to find ways to decrease auto theft. It was discovered that the most effective method to deter theft from autos is to create a time delay that the thief cannot avoid.
While there is no way to "re-learn" the resistance code of a VATS key the control module can be reset. To restore the function it is necessary to replace the key.
